ABC is set to enhance its Tuesday night programming with the introduction of a new special investigator series titled “RJ Decker.” The show features Scott Speedman in the lead role, alongside a talented cast including Jaina Lee Ortiz as Emilia “Emi” Ochoa, Bevin Bru as Detective Melody “Mel” Abreau, Kevin Rankin as Aloysius “Wish” Aiken, and Adelaide Clemens as Catherine Delacroix.
Inspired by Carl Hiaasen’s novel “Double Whammy,” “RJ Decker” centers on a disgraced newspaper photographer and ex-con attempting to reinvent himself as a private investigator in the vibrant yet crime-ridden landscape of South Florida. The storyline presents a unique blend of cases that are ranging from the mildly unusual to the outright bizarre, highlighting Decker’s journey as he navigates his new career with the help of his journalist ex-girlfriend, her police detective wife, and a mysterious benefactor from his past.
The series is scheduled to premiere on March 3 at 10 PM on ABC, with availability for streaming the following day on Hulu and Hulu on Disney+.
In conjunction with this new addition, “The Rookie” will shift toMonday nights at 10 PM, starting January 26, right after the premiere of “American Idol.” This move will allow “The Rookie” to air its remaining episodes consecutively without interruptions.
